The song "II. Demigod" by Mick Gordon, with its powerful and dark lyrics, portrays the unstoppable and merciless nature of the Doom Slayer, a character from the video game "Doom." The lyrics convey a message of strength, determination, and the pursuit of justice in the face of overwhelming evil.

The opening lines, "Tempered by the fires of hell, His iron will remained steadfast through the passage," symbolize the Doom Slayer's resilience and unwavering resolve, having endured the trials and tribulations of hell itself. The lyrics emphasize his relentless pursuit of justice, describing how he preys upon the weak and hunts down the minions of doom with "barbarous cruelty."

The phrases "unbreakable, incorruptible, unyielding" highlight the Doom Slayer's unwavering dedication to his mission, emphasizing his invincibility and refusal to back down. The lyrics also suggest that the horde of enemies he faces is formidable, but none can withstand his might.

The final line, "For he alone was the hell walker," brings focus to the unique nature of the Doom Slayer's character. He is presented as a force beyond mortals, standing alone as the ultimate warrior against the forces of evil.

In summary, the lyrics of "II. Demigod" convey a message of an indomitable hero fighting against darkness and wickedness, embodying strength, courage, and the relentless pursuit of justice.
